La solucion aqu� est� en programa los ip-up.d e ip-down.d para que
hagan unas cosas u otras en funci�n de un determinado valor, que aqu� ser�
el IP que te da el proveedor.
Como puedes saber el rango de direcciones IP que te da el proveedor
(mira los logs si tienes la depuraci�n activada en el pppd), puedes hacer
algo del estilo de:
(en perl)
if ( $IP =~ /192\.168\.4\./)
{ # configuracion para servidor X }
if ( $IP =~ /195\.134\.110\./)
{ # configuracion para servidor Y}
Es la forma m�s sencilla de hacerlo (creo). Aunque el problema viene
si tienes varias m�quinas conectadas a la que tiene el modem (yo en casa
tengo dos), en la que si modificas el /etc/resolv.conf tienes que modificar
la de todas las m�quinas (yo tengo esto en casa con ip_forwarding, y diald :)
La soluci�n aqu� es poner un demonio de DNS (bind) en el que tiene
el modem, y que las otras tengan como resolver el servidor con modem.
Pero bueno, lo que no se pueda hacer con Linux no est� escrito :)
Saludos
Javi
On Mon, Oct 12, 1998 at 09:44:59PM +0200, Juan Manuel Gimeno Illa wrote:
> Hola a todos,
>
> he estado configurando los scripts y dem�s para conectarme a
> internet usando /etc/chatscripts/proveedor y /etc/ppp/peers/proveedor, y
> todo funciona muy bien. El problema es que tengo diferentes proveedores y,
> claro, 'pon proveedor' no me cambia el /etc/resolf.config dependiendo de a
> cual me he conectado (y tambi�n ejecutar o no algunas cosas del ip-up.d e
> ip-down.d dependiendo de �l).
>
> He pensado en hacerme un script que fuera como el pon, pero que
> adem�s arreglara algunas cosillas como por ejemplo tener resolv.conf por
> proveedor y antes de la coneci�n, que resolv.conf se linkara al que toque
> (y lo mismo con ip-up.d, ip-down.d). �Hay alguna soluci�n mejor?
>
> Otra pregunta, �sta sobre permisos: para que el pon me funcionara
> he hecho suid tanto el chat como el pppd. �Hay alguna soluci�n mejor?
>
> Por cierto, tengo Debian 2.0
>
> Much�sismas gracias
>
> Juan Manuel
>
> +---------------------------------------------------------------------+
> + Babui | [EMAIL PROTECTED] | http://www.ctv.es/USERS/jmgimeno/home.htm +
> +---------------------------------------------------------------------+
> + But if the while I think on thee (dear friend) William Shakespeare +
> + All losses are restored, and sorrows end. Sonnets, XXX +
> +---------------------------------------------------------------------+
>
>
> --
> Unsubscribe? mail -s unsubscribe [EMAIL PROTECTED] < /dev/null
>